Political Science & Government is the 20th most popular major in the country with 49,282 degrees awarded in 2020-2021. In 2019-2020, political science and government graduates who were awarded their degree in 2017-2019, earned an average of $34,387 and had an average of $23,175 in loans still to pay off.

Across Virginia, there were 1,786 political science and government graduates with average earnings and debt of $37,500 and $25,463 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 1,685 political science and government graduates with average earnings and debt of $39,553 and $27,844 respectively.

This year’s “Schools for a Bachelor’s Highly Focused on Political Science Major in Virginia” ranking looked at 36 colleges that offer degrees in a bachelor’s in political science and government. The colleges and universities that top this list are recognized because their political science and government program is one of the largest majors offered at the school.
